The MagiCut 123 Flex transfer paper is a versatile product specifically designed for use on cotton and polyester materials. It features an adhesive backing suitable for both hot and cold peeling, allowing for flexible handling. With a width of 50 cm, it provides ample space for various designs and applications. The transfer paper is available in the color group black and is made from high-quality vinyl, ensuring a durable and reliable transfer of motifs. Manufactured in China, it is a practical tool for creative projects, whether in a professional setting or for personal use. The solid color design allows for easy integration into different designs and styles. The MagiCut 123 Flex transfer paper is therefore an ideal choice for anyone looking to customize their textiles.
